Overview:
The Integrated Oil Division is looking for a Contract Project Planning/ Scheduling Coordinator to oversee and contribute to all aspects of schedule development and maintenance for the [Company] Foster Creek/Christina Lake IOD Projects.
Responsibilities:
- leads the continuous development and maintenance of the integrated Master Project Schedule ensuring that contractors', subcontractors' and fabricators' schedules, together with material deliveries and owners' tasks are meeting project milestone dates as agreed by all parties
- work with owner's staff and contractors to develop and status schedules for their project components
- evaluate CMT schedules and perform site scheduling audits
- ensure Master Project Schedule activities are coded by the project work breakdown structure for cost / schedule integration and analysis
- define and optimize critical paths, perform total float analysis and notify project management status of critical activities and schedule risks
- conduct "what-if" scenarios, recovery plans, contingency planning and schedule compression techniques
- provide planning interface to drilling, pre-commissioning & commissioning and system start-up planning
- support CMT monitoring of contractor actual progress versus planned progress and key performance indicators, provide exception reporting, and recommend actions
- produce reports and analysis using Primavera and other system outputs such as bar charts, S-curves, manpower histograms, and Schedule Performance Indexes
- provide support on development of project cost expenditure forecast curves
- perform schedule risk analysis (gather data, input data, analyze, report) on a periodic basis or as required
- seek innovation in scheduling and execution plans that could improve project economics
- functional support to independent project reviews
- develop and mentor direct reports and other project staff
- promote safety leadership and Owner HSE requirements
